| Music and lyrics by Prabhat Ranjan Sarkar | |
| Song number | 0650 |
| Date | 1983 July 6 |
| Place | Madhumalainca, Kolkata |
| Theme | Longing |
| Lyrics | Bengali |
| Music | Dadra, Ragas Pilu + Thumri (Dhrupad) |

Asha niye patha ceye is the 650th song of Prabhat Ranjan Sarkar's Prabhat Samgiita.[1][2]
